We propose noble magnetically tunable color changing surface composed of magnetic nanocomposite micro-actuators. The self-assembling behaviorof superpara-magnetic nanoparticles enables both color generation and color changing. To achieve this, we fabricate micro-sized magnetic nanocomposite actuatorsby repetitivelyfixing the assembled state of the superparamagnetic nano-particles in a polymer matrix with a desired shape.Using this technology, we fabricate red, green and blue colored microactuators and observe their color change.This research offers very simple fabrication and operation method for color tunable surface. |
